ios程序打包越狱版本

2 2024-10-21 08:15:22

打包越狱版本指的是将iOS应用程序适配并安装到越狱设备上运行。在越狱设备上,用户可以通过第三方应用商店或其他途径安装未经过苹果App Store审核的应用。下面我将详细介绍iOS程序打包越狱版本的原理及步骤。

1. 越狱设备:首先,我们需要一台已经越狱的iOS设备,这样我们才能在设备上安装越狱应用。越狱设备可以通过多种方法越狱,例如使用工具软件,或者通过硬件漏洞进行越狱等。

2. 应用适配:越狱设备上的操作系统和非越狱设备上的操作系统存在一些差异,因此需要将应用适配到越狱设备上才能正常运行。适配的过程包括修改应用的代码和设置,以确保在越狱设备上能够正确加载。

3. 获取应用程序:获取需要打包的应用程序文件,通常是ipa文件。ipa文件是iOS应用程序的打包文件,包含了应用程序的二进制文件、资源文件等。

4. 解包ipa文件:使用解包工具,例如ipa file manager,将ipa文件解包成可编辑的文件夹。

5. 修改应用程序:进入解包后的文件夹,我们可以修改应用程序的代码和设置。根据具体需求,可以修改应用程序的图标、启动画面、配置文件等。

6. 重新打包:修改完成后,使用打包工具,例如iOS App Signer,将修改后的文件夹重新打包成ipa文件。

7. 安装应用程序:将重新打包的ipa文件安装到越狱设备上。可以通过多种方式进行安装,例如使用第三方应用商店,或者通过命令行工具进行安装。

需要注意的是,打包越狱版本的应用程序存在一定的风险和法律问题。未经过苹果App Store审核的应用可能存在安全隐患,且违反了苹果的使用条款。因此,对于普通用户来说,建议只下载并使用经过苹果App Store审核的应用程序。

总结起来,打包越狱版本的应用程序需要一台已经越狱的设备,并且需要进行一系列的操作,包括修改应用程序、重新打包和安装应用程序。然而,由于安全和法律问题,建议普通用户仅使用经过苹果App Store审核的应用。

上一篇:ios移动开发之快速打包工具
下一篇:ios离线打包启动后的这个提示
相关文章